Output d6d51340868ddf678b98f0ac06416b78cd4436330d127e057d3047627aaeed53:1

value
42086709
script pubkey
OP_HASH160 OP_PUSHBYTES_20 967b8b90c275180251918fe94dbc46e37eafb365 OP_EQUAL
address
3FQhHPSdVWvUWFjACdywrsFFNHrU2nCjWy
transaction
d6d51340868ddf678b98f0ac06416b78cd4436330d127e057d3047627aaeed53
spent
true